You had to file a tax return for that you year these two years before the bankruptcy. To become eligible to wipe the actual debt, cause have filed a tax return for the internal revenue service or State debt you'd like to discharge at least two years before declaring bankruptcy. Thus, even when the debts are over three years old, inside your filed the return late and two years has not passed, want cannot remove the Internal revenue service or State tax money.

In 2003 the JGTRRA, or Jobs and Growth Tax Relief Reconciliation Act, was passed, expanding the 10% tax bracket and accelerating some within the changes passed in the 2001 EGTRRA.
